School Teddy Bear Girl Card

This card can give to a special classmate or friend in your class as cheer someone up when she is down whatever reason, you can write your own message or stamp your own sentiment inside of the card and also can use sticker too. I have issue with rouge glitter cardstock from American Crafts, because the red is too light, so what I did was apply Xmas Red Stickles on the glitter cardstock to make it darker.

"All the Teddy Bear pieces cut @ 3 1/2" inches"

Occasion: Just Because
Cricut Cartridge: Teddy Bear Parade

Type of Card: Standard A2 Size Card (4 1/4" x 5 1/2")
Card Measurement: Cut 8 1/2" (Length) x 5 1/2" (Wide) Score in half  @ 4 1/4" 

Mats (2) Size: 4" x 5 1/4"

Materials I use on this card are:
  • Stampin Up Card Stock Current Colors and Retire Colors
  • Glitter Specialty Paper From American Crafts Black and Rouge (Red)
  • Dry Adhesive, 2 Ways Glue Pen and Scotch Quick-Dry Adhesive   
  • Swarvoski Crystal Flatback "Crystal" ss16 (4mm) and ss5 (1mm) (Hand apply with E6000 Glue and Hotfix)
  • Xmas Red Stickles
  • Sakura White Gel Pen  
  • Cuttlebug Embossing Folder "Swiss Dots"
